What companies run services between Turkey and Suez, Egypt?

There is no direct connection from Turkey to Suez. However, you can take the taxi to Cukurova (COV) airport, fly to Cairo International Airport (CAI), walk to Cairo Airport Bridge, take the line 111 bus to Al Galaa bridge, walk to Cairo, then take the bus to Suez. Alternatively, you can take the line 442 bus to Ankara Airport, walk to Ankara Esenboğa International Airport (ESB) airport, fly to Cairo International Airport (CAI), walk to Cairo Airport Bridge, take the line 111 bus to Al Galaa bridge, walk to Cairo, then take the bus to Suez.
